| Title | Of a Rose I Sing a Song |
| Alternative title | Carol for a Small Choir, Harp, 'Cello & Contrabass |
| Creators | Arnold Bax (composer) |
| Opus | GP 234 |
| Instrumentation | mixed chorus, harp, cello and double bass |
| Number of movements | 1 |
| Keys | — |
| Composed | 1920 |
| First published | 1921 |
| Dedication | Leigh Henry |
| Tempo markings | — |
| Metronome markings | — |
| Time signatures | — |
| Average duration (sec) | 480 |
| Number of measures | — |
| Composition types | Carols |
| Language | English |
| Period | Early 20th century |
